Output 6732d00b31b240e031aa6e93da0e0330eb7ee891a585e8b5a23e97dac9176d5c:20

value
193006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d0b1339be4dc3715e6d18b89845152646f19611 OP_EQUAL
address
3MqnXT34LJFUewx2sSHyJ1LGiCfqwXvaDs
transaction
6732d00b31b240e031aa6e93da0e0330eb7ee891a585e8b5a23e97dac9176d5c
confirmations
232533
spent
true